Background
Tyrosinase, found in the membrane of melanosomes (1), is a key enzyme in the biosynthesis of melanin pigments (1,2). It is a melanocyte differentiation antigen and is expressed in normal melanocytes and malignant melanomas (1,3). Tyrosinase is implicated to be an antigen target for melanoma vaccines (1).
